The OP07CSZ is a high-precision operational amplifier from Analog Devices Inc., designed to offer improved performance over industry-standard OP07 devices. This op-amp is known for its low offset voltage and drift, making it an excellent choice for applications requiring precise measurements and consistent long-term performance.
Key Features
- Ultra-Low Offset Voltage: The OP07CSZ boasts an offset voltage as low as 75 µV, which is ideal for high-accuracy applications.
- Low Offset Voltage Drift: With a drift of only ±1.3 µV/°C, the device ensures stability over a wide temperature range.
- Low Noise: It features a low noise voltage of 0.6 µV p-p (0.1 Hz to 10 Hz), making it suitable for sensitive audio and instrumentation applications.
- High Input Impedance: The high input impedance minimizes the impact on the signal source and is beneficial for precision applications.
- Wide Supply Range: The OP07CSZ can operate from ±3 V to ±18 V dual supplies, providing flexibility in various circuit designs.
Applications
The OP07CSZ is versatile and can be used in a wide range of applications, including:
- Instrumentation amplifiers
- Precision data systems
- Analog processors
- Strain gauge amplifiers
- Thermocouple amplifiers
- DC gain blocks
- Industrial controls
